A superb bright yellow foliage form of this excellent late-flowering deciduous shrub, the leaves turning greeny-yellow with age. A profusion of sky blue flowers, very attractive to bees and butterflies, appear in late July and are produced all the way through to October. Trim quite hard to shape in spring.

Position: Prefers a well drained soil in a sunny position.
Pruning: Prune hard back in spring.
